Aug 1, 2024Administrative complaint recommendedRoutine Inspection

Referred for a formal case, which can lead to a fine. 12 violations recorded, 3 high priority.

3 High priority3 Intermediate6 Basic
What the inspector wrote — 12 findings
Nonfood-grade bags used in direct contact with food. Frozen corn fritters stored in mini trash bags at walk in freezer
High priority/14-31-5
Operating with an expired Division of Hotels and Restaurants license. License expired 4/1/23
High priority/50-17-3/Admin Complaint
Toxic substance/chemical improperly stored. Windex and cleaner stored on storage shelf over canned pineapple juice and to go tops
High priority/41-10-4/Corrected On-Site
Handwash sink used for purposes other than handwashing. Hand wash sink at bar had a strainer with wet napkins and straws
Intermediate/31A-11-4/Corrected On-Site
